Abstract

The invention relates to a sodium sulfide production sedimentation system which comprises a circular sedimentation tank, wherein a vertical first sewage discharge pipeline is arranged in the center of the bottom of the sedimentation tank, an annular vibration type air cushion is arranged at the bottom of the sedimentation tank, and the vibration type air cushion is arranged outside the first sewage discharge pipeline. The sodium sulfide production sedimentation system only needs one person to finish the desilting operation of the alkali mud after settling the crude alkali liquor of sodium sulfide, and the desilting effect is good, and the desilting worker need not to go down to the bottom of the pool of sedimentation tank and carries out the desilting operation, effectively ensures workman's safety, and whole desilting time is no longer than 2 hours, uses manpower and materials sparingly, and the desilting is efficient, and it is effectual to implement.

Background
In the large-scale production process of sodium sulfide (such as 2 ten thousand tons produced in a year), a sedimentation tank is generally adopted to carry out sedimentation clarification on crude sodium sulfide alkaline liquor containing a large amount of alkaline mud, after the crude alkaline liquor enters the sedimentation tank and is clarified for a certain time, the supernatant is an effective component, and the bottom layer is the alkaline mud. After the sedimentation in the sedimentation tank is finished, extracting the supernatant, and then removing the bottom layer impurities to finish the work.
The existing sedimentation basin is generally built by pouring concrete, and the surface of the sedimentation basin is subjected to anticorrosion and waterproof treatment. A sewage discharge channel is arranged in the center of the bottom of the sedimentation tank, a sludge pump is adopted for cleaning, but the amount of alkali mud is too large; for example, in a 50-ton sedimentation tank, the alkali mud exceeds 1 ton, and at present, a worker usually wears a protective clothing on the alkali mud to clean the alkali mud, shovels the alkali mud into a hanging basket at the bottom of the sedimentation tank, and transfers the alkali mud away by using the hanging basket; when the amount of the alkali mud to be cleaned exceeds 80%, workers leave the sedimentation tank, a high-pressure water gun is used for washing the sedimentation tank, sewage containing a large amount of alkali mud is discharged from a sewage discharge channel in the center of the bottom of the sedimentation tank, and a sludge pump or a submersible sewage discharge pump is used for discharging the sewage to a designated area.
The method for cleaning the alkali mud in the settling pond wastes time and labor, the settling pond with 50 tons usually needs four workers to clean for more than 3 hours, and the workers must wear full-protection protective clothing, so that the working environment is severe, and unsafe accidents are easy to happen once the operation is improper.

Example 1
As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the sodium sulfide production settling system includes a circular settling basin 10, a vertical first sewage pipe 11 is disposed in the center of the bottom of the settling basin 10, a circular vibration type air cushion 20 is disposed at the bottom of the settling basin 10, and the vibration type air cushion 20 is disposed outside the first sewage pipe 11.
The sedimentation tank 10 is formed by pouring concrete into a tank body, and the inner wall of the tank body is coated with a protective layer made of epoxy resin floor paint. The epoxy resin floor paint has the characteristics of wear resistance, corrosion resistance, oil stain resistance, heavy pressure resistance and smooth surface.
Example 2
Based on embodiment 1, as shown in fig. 1 and 3, the vibrating air cushion 20 includes a sealing cloth 21, a projection of the sealing cloth 21 on the bottom of the sedimentation tank 10 is a circular ring, one side of the sealing cloth 21 is hermetically connected with the inner side wall of the sedimentation tank 10, and the other side of the sealing cloth 21 is hermetically connected with the bottom of the sedimentation tank 10; an air bag space 22 is defined between the sealing cloth 21 and the inner wall of the sedimentation basin 10, a plurality of groups of conical spring groups are arranged in the air bag space 22, and each conical spring group consists of a plurality of conical springs 25 which are arranged along the radial direction of the sedimentation basin 10; a permanent magnet sheet 24 arranged at the upper end of a conical spring 25 is further arranged in the air bag space 22, the cross section of the permanent magnet sheet 24 is arc-shaped, one side of the permanent magnet sheet 24 is fixedly connected with the sealing cloth 21, and the other side of the permanent magnet sheet 24 is fixedly connected with the upper end of the conical spring 25; a plate-shaped electromagnet 23 is arranged below the conical spring 25, and the electromagnet 23 is fixedly connected with the bottom of the sedimentation basin 10; an annular chamber 26 is arranged below the sedimentation basin 10, a through hole 15 for communicating the chamber 26 with the air bag space 22 is further arranged at the bottom of the sedimentation basin 10, and a valve 27 communicated with the chamber 26 is arranged outside the sedimentation basin 10.
Further, a second sewage discharge pipeline 12 communicated with the first sewage discharge pipeline 11 is arranged below the bottom of the sedimentation basin 10, and a sewage discharge valve 13 is installed at the tail end of the second sewage discharge pipeline 12.
Further, the internally mounted of first blowdown pipeline 11 has vibrating spear 40, the barred body of vibrating spear 40 is located the inside of first blowdown pipeline 11, and the inside of the metal box of settling basin 10 below is installed to the remaining part of vibrating spear 40, the external diameter of the barred body of vibrating spear 40 is less than the internal diameter of first blowdown pipeline 11. The vibrating rod 40 may be a vibrating rod used in the concrete field, for example, a concrete high frequency vibrating rod of fudike technologies ltd.
A sludge pump is also connected with the blow-down valve 13. The specific use method of the sodium sulfide production sedimentation system comprises the following steps: the crude sodium sulfide lye is conveyed to the interior of the sedimentation basin 10 for sedimentation, after the sedimentation is finished, the supernatant in the interior of the sedimentation basin 10 is pumped away, and the residual alkali mud and the residual alkali lye are accompanied by the residual alkali lye in the interior of the sedimentation basin 10.
When the cleaning operation is required, clear water is firstly poured into the sedimentation tank 10, the amount of the poured clear water exceeds more than half of the volume of the sedimentation tank 10, then the vibrating rod 40 is started, the alkali mud deposited on the part of the vibrating rod 40 is vibrated and stirred, the blow-off valve 13 and the sludge pump are opened, the first blow-off pipeline 11 is dredged under the high-frequency vibration of the vibrating rod 40, and the alkali mud mixed water is conveyed to a designated area through the first blow-off pipeline 11, the second blow-off pipeline 12 and the blow-off valve 13 in sequence.
When the alkaline sludge in the sedimentation basin 10 is cleaned by more than 90%, most of the alkaline sludge is attached to the bottom of the sedimentation basin 10, i.e. to the surface of the vibrating air cushions 20. At this time, an air compressor is externally connected through a valve 27, compressed air is injected into the cavity 26, the through hole 15 and the air bag space 22 until the air pressure in the air bag space 22 is 1.11 to 1.13 atmospheric pressures, the electromagnet 23 is electrified to generate magnetic force which is repulsive to the permanent magnet sheet 24, and therefore the sealing cloth 21 is jacked up; because the cross section of the electromagnet 23 is arc-shaped, and the sealing cloth 21 is further tightened by injecting compressed air, the sealing cloth 21 forms an arc-shaped surface protruding outwards finally, as shown in fig. 3; the valve 27 is closed. Then, the interior of the sedimentation basin 10 is flushed by a high-pressure water gun, in the flushing process, the electromagnet 23 is powered off, and the sealing cloth 21 which protrudes outwards is pressed into a sealing surface which is concave downwards under the action of the pressure of water above the sealing cloth 21, as shown by dotted lines in fig. 4; then the electromagnet 23 is electrified, and the sealing cloth 21 can be bounced from bottom to top and is straightened; then the electromagnet 23 is powered off, and the sealing cloth 21 is pressed from top to bottom in a concave manner; thus, as the electromagnet 23 is intermittently energized (for example, 2 to 5 seconds, 2 to 3 seconds, 2 to 5 seconds, and then 2 to 3 seconds …), the sealing cloth 21 will continuously shake up and down, and during this process, the alkaline sludge attached to the surface of the sealing cloth 21 will be continuously washed away and will flow away along with the water flowing to the first drainage pipe 11.
Finally, even if dry alkaline mud is attached to the surface of the sealing cloth 21, the surface of the sealing cloth 21 can be cleaned up by matching with a high-pressure water gun to wash in the process of shaking the sealing cloth 21 up and down. And the alkaline mud in the rest area of the sedimentation basin 10 can be washed by water flow or a high-pressure water gun. When the surface of sealed cloth 21 by the sanitization, just also accomplish the desilting operation to the sedimentation tank 10 inside, the desilting is effectual, only needs can accomplish the desilting operation alone, and the desilting workman need not to go down to the bottom of the pool of sedimentation tank 10 and carries out the desilting operation, and whole desilting time is no longer than 2 hours, the material resources of using manpower sparingly, and the desilting is efficient, and the desilting is effectual.
When the water pressure above the sealing cloth 21 is not high enough, the electromagnet 23 is electrified to generate magnetic force which is attracted with the permanent magnet sheet 24, so that the permanent magnet sheet 24 moves downwards, and the sealing cloth 21 is ensured to be in a continuous shaking process.
The conical spring 25 has a buffering effect, and the contact area between the upper end of the conical spring 25 and the sealing cloth 21 is small, so that the sealing cloth 21 can form an arc-shaped structure to the maximum extent after being tightened upwards. When the interior of the sedimentation basin 10 is filled with the sodium sulfide crude alkali liquor, the conical spring 25 is compressed to the limit, and the conical spring 25 in the state mainly plays a role in supporting the sealing cloth 21 and preventing the sealing cloth 21 from being collapsed. The structure of the conical spring 25 with large top and small bottom can leave enough space for the sealing cloth 21 to shake up and down.
In the subsequent cleaning process, no matter the water pressure or the electromagnetic attraction causes the conical spring 25 to be compressed, the conical spring 25 does not need to be compressed to the limit; the reason is that during the washing process, the water pressure is not sufficient to compress the conical spring 25 to the limit; the conical spring 25 is compressed to the limit by adopting the electromagnetic attraction, so that a large amount of electric energy is consumed and cannot be paid; therefore, the conical spring 25 does not need to be compressed to the limit.
Before the crude sodium sulfide lye is conveyed to the sedimentation tank 10, the valve 27 is opened to make the air pressure inside the air bag space 22 be normal pressure, when the sedimentation tank 10 is filled with the crude sodium sulfide lye, the air pressure inside the air bag space 22 is also normal pressure, and then the valve 27 is closed.
Example 3
As shown in fig. 4, the distance between the joint of the sealing cloth 21 and the bottom of the sedimentation basin 10 and the joint of the sealing cloth 21 and the inner side wall of the sedimentation basin 10 is x, where x is the length of the dotted line in fig. 4; as shown in fig. 5, the maximum value of the cross-sectional length of the sealing cloth 21 is y, and z is y/x, and 1.022 ≦ z < 1.051.
In fig. 4, the dotted line corresponds to a limit state that the seal cloth 21 can be depressed, which is an arc in a mathematical model, and in actual operation, the seal cloth 21 is not depressed to reach the limit state, so z ≠ 1.051. y cannot be too large, otherwise the sealing cloth 21 cannot be tightened, the cambered surface structure cannot be achieved when the sealing cloth is tightened upwards, and a plurality of fold structures exist on the surface even if the sealing cloth is subsequently supported. y cannot be too small, otherwise, even if the sealing cloth 21 can be tightened, the undulation degree of the sealing cloth 21 is not enough, which is not favorable for the smooth flowing down of the alkali mud on the surface of the sealing cloth 21 along the surface of the sealing cloth 21. In this range z, the cross section of the seal cloth 21 tends to be a curved surface structure after being tightened upward.
Example 4
In the case of the conical spring group according to example 2, the height of the conical springs 25 arranged in the radial direction of the sedimentation basin 10 in the natural state changes linearly. Although in fig. 4, the cross section of the upwardly-tightened sealing cloth 21 is arc-shaped, if the height change of the conical spring 25 in the natural state is designed according to the change of the arc surface, the design is very complicated, and after many times of practice and parameter optimization, the linear change of the height of the conical spring 25 in the natural state is found to satisfy the support property when the conical spring 25 is compressed to the limit; the reason is that when the conical spring 25 is compressed to the limit, the sealing cloth 21 is also tightened to the limit, and the sealing cloth 21 can balance the adjacent conical spring 25, so that the conical spring 25 can normally exert the bearing function.

Example 6
The manufacturing method of the sealing cloth 21 comprises the following steps:
step one, spraying an aluminum spraying layer with the thickness of 70-80 microns on the surface of glass fiber cloth in the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th by utilizing aluminum powder for thermal spraying; the thermal spraying process of aluminum powder is a mature technology and is not described in detail herein.
Step two, mixing lead pow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 mu m and pol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 mu m into a first mixture according to the mass ratio of 7:3, and spraying a first mixture layer with the thickness of 200-220 mu m on the surface of the aluminum spraying layer by utilizing the first mixture for thermal spraying at the spraying temperature of 390-395 ℃;
step three, mixing lead pow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ns and pol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ns according to the mass ratio of 1:1 to form a second mixture, and spraying a second mixture layer with the thickness of 310-330 microns on the surface of the first mixture layer by utilizing the second mixture for thermal spraying, wherein the spraying temperature is 390-395 ℃;
step three, mixing lead pow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ns and pol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ns according to the mass ratio of 3:7 to form a third mixture, and spraying a third mixture layer with the thickness of 430-470 microns on the surface of the second mixture layer by utilizing the third mixture for thermal spraying, wherein the spraying temperature is 390-395 ℃;
step four, mixing lead pow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ns and pol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ns according to the mass ratio of 1:9 to form a fourth mixture, and performing thermal spraying on the surface of the third mixture layer by using the fourth mixture to spray a fourth mixture layer with the thickness of 560-;
and step five, performing electrostatic spraying on pol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 microns to spray a polytetrafluoroethylene coating with the thickness of more than 1mm on the surface of the fourth mixed layer, sintering the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th with the polytetrafluoroethylene coating at the temperature of 375-380 ℃, and cooling to obtain the sealing cloth 21.
Wherein the melting point of the polytetrafluoroethylene is 327 ℃ and the boiling point is 400 ℃; the melting point of the metal lead is 328 ℃, so that the lead powder and the polytetrafluoroethylene powder can be mixed and sprayed by adopting a thermal spraying process, and the spraying temperature is controlled to be 390-; the sintering temperature of the polytetrafluoroethylene is controlled at 375-380 ℃, and after sintering, the first mixed layer, the second mixed layer, the third mixed layer, the fourth mixed layer and the polytetrafluoroethylene coating can be sintered into a whole, so that tight combination is ensured. The function of mixing metal lead is to enable the metal lead to be tightly combined with the aluminum spraying layer, and the surface of the glass fiber cloth cover in the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th is rough and can be tightly combined with the aluminum spraying layer; from inside to outside, the content (mass ratio) of the metal lead is reduced from 70% to 50%, 30%, 10% and 0% in sequence, and the first mixed layer with the highest lead content is tightly combined with the aluminum spraying layer; and then, sequentially increasing the content of the polytetrafluoroethylene powder from 30% to 50%, 70%, 90% and 100%, and solving the technical defect that the polytetrafluoroethylene is not easily combined with other materials by sequentially increasing the content of the polytetrafluoroethylene.
The seal cloth 21 was subjected to a folding test:
step S1, folding the sealing cloth 21 in half by using a folding machine, and rolling the crease by using a press roller, wherein the pressure during rolling is 10 bar;
step S2, flattening the folded sealing cloth 21, folding the sealing cloth 21 along the crease of the sealing cloth 21 again, and rolling the crease by adopting a press roller, wherein the pressure during rolling is 10 bar;
and step S3, repeating the step S2 for a plurality of times, and recording the folding times.
After 100 folds of the finished sealing cloth 21, the folds are shown in fig. 9. After the finished sealing cloth 21 is folded for 1000 times, a water seepage test is carried out, and no water seepage phenomenon is found.
Example 7
The manufacturing method of the contrast cloth X comprises the following steps:
step one, spraying an aluminum spraying layer with the thickness of 70-80 microns on the surface of glass fiber cloth in the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th by utilizing aluminum powder for thermal spraying; the thermal spraying process of aluminum powder is a mature technology and is not described in detail herein.
Step two, mixing lead pow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 mu m and pol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 mu m according to the mass ratio of 1:1 to form a second mixture, and spraying a mixed layer P with the thickness of 1500-1620 mu m on the surface of the aluminum spraying layer by utilizing the second mixture for thermal spraying at the spraying temperature of 390-395 ℃;
and step three, carrying out electrostatic spraying on pol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 mu m to spray a polytetrafluoroethylene coating with the thickness of 1mm on the surface of the mixing layer P, sintering the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th with the polytetrafluoroethylene coating at 380 ℃ of 375-.
Among them, the thickness of the polytetrafluoroethylene coating layer in example 6 is preferably 1mm, as compared with this example.
Folding test was performed with control cloth X:
step S1, folding the contrast cloth X in half by using a folding machine, and rolling at the crease by using a press roller, wherein the pressure during rolling is 10 bar;
step S2, flattening the folded contrast cloth X, folding the contrast cloth X again along the crease of the contrast cloth X, and rolling the crease by adopting a press roller at the pressure of 10 bar;
and step S3, repeating the step S2 for a plurality of times, and recording the folding times.
After 100 folds of the contrast cloth X, the fold is as shown in fig. 10; and (5) carrying out a water permeability test to find that no water permeability phenomenon exists.
Example 8
The method for manufacturing the control cloth Y is as follows:
and (3) performing electrostatic spraying on polytetrafluoroethylene powder with the particle size of less than or equal to 35 mu m to spray a polytetrafluoroethylene coating with the thickness of 2.6-2.7mm on the surface of the glass fiber cloth in the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th, sintering the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th with the polytetrafluoroethylene coating at the temperature of 375-380 ℃, and cooling to obtain the contrast cloth Y.
Among them, the thickness of the polytetrafluoroethylene coating layer in example 6 is preferably 1mm, as compared with this example.
Folding test was performed with control cloth Y:
step S1, folding the contrast cloth Y in half by using a folding machine, and rolling the crease by using a press roller, wherein the pressure during rolling is 10 bar;
step S2, flattening the folded contrast cloth Y, folding the contrast cloth Y again along the crease of the contrast cloth Y, and rolling the crease by adopting a press roller, wherein the pressure during rolling is 10 bar;
and step S3, repeating the step S2 for a plurality of times, and recording the folding times.
After the comparison cloth Y is folded for 65 times, the folding mark is shown in figure 11; and (5) carrying out a water seepage test to find that a water seepage phenomenon occurs.
By analyzing examples 6 to 8, it can be seen that:
firstly, if pure polytetrafluoroethylene is adopted to carry out spraying on the folded glass fiber cloth, even if sintering treatment is adopted subsequently, the combination effect between the polytetrafluoroethylene and the glass fiber cloth is effective, after multiple times of folding and rolling, obvious damage appears at the crease, even the water seepage phenomenon appears at the crease, which fully explains the poor combination force between the polytetrafluoroethylene and the glass fiber cloth.
Secondly, if the priming is carried out by spraying pure aluminum firstly, then the lead powder and the polytetrafluoroethylene powder are mixed according to the mass ratio of 1:1 for thermal spraying to prepare an intermediate layer, and finally the polytetrafluoroethylene coating is sprayed, although the binding force between the polytetrafluoroethylene and other materials can be improved, the improvement effect is limited; as can be seen from the analysis of fig. 10 and 11: the creases in FIG. 10 are worn less, and no significant water seepage is observed through the water seepage test; however, as can be seen from comparison of fig. 9, the seal cloth 21 manufactured by the manufacturing process of the present invention has no obvious damage at the fold even after being folded and rolled many times, and the remaining trace is shallow, and there is no water seepage at the fold, which fully indicates that the bonding force between the polytetrafluoroethylene and the glass fiber cloth is excellent.
Example 9
As shown in fig. 6-8, a first connecting ring 51 is disposed between the sealing cloth 21 and the inner side wall of the sedimentation tank 10, the cross-sectional structure of the first connecting ring 51 is an acute angle structure, the first connecting ring 51 includes a vertical cylindrical first ring body 511 matched with the inner side wall of the sedimentation tank 10, the first ring body 511 and the inner side wall of the sedimentation tank 10 are hermetically connected by using metal glue, an inner edge 512 is disposed at the upper end of the first ring body 511, the tail end of the inner edge 512 is integrally connected with the upper end of the first ring body 511, the height of the head end of the inner edge 512 is lower than that of the tail end of the inner edge 512, and the sealing cloth 21 and the inner edge 512 are hermetically connected by using metal glue; be provided with second clamping ring 52 between the bottom of pool of sealed cloth 21 and sedimentation tank 10, second clamping ring 52 includes ring form gasket 521, gasket 521 adopts metal glue sealing connection with the bottom of pool of sedimentation tank 10, the outer edge of gasket 521 is provided with the turn-ups 522 that upwards turns up, the lower extreme of turn-ups 522 is connected as an organic whole with the outer edge of gasket 521, the contained angle between turn-ups 522 and the gasket 521 is the acute angle, adopt metal glue sealing connection between sealed cloth 21 and the turn-ups 522.
First connector link 51 and second connector link 52 are as the carrier of connecting, and sealed cloth 21 links to each other with first connector link 51, second connector link 52, even follow-up damaged sealed cloth 21 that needs to be changed, only need cut out the both ends of sealed cloth 21, then clear away first connector link 51 and the remaining sealed cloth 21 in second connector link 52 surface can. The inner edge 512 can be separated from the first ring body 511 by directly adopting a cutting machine, and then replaced by welding a new inner edge 512; similarly, the flanging 522 can be separated from the gasket 521 by a cutting machine directly, and then replaced by welding a new flanging 522.
The gasket 521 is fixedly connected with the bottom of the sedimentation tank 10 by installing expansion screws, and then is sealed and reconnected by using metal glue. Similarly, the first ring 511 is fixedly connected with the inner side wall of the sedimentation basin 10 by installing expansion screws, and then is sealed and reconnected by using metal glue.
In the embodiment, the first connecting ring 51 and the second connecting ring 52 are arranged, so that subsequent replacement and maintenance are facilitated.
Example 10
In embodiment 9, the connection manner of the seal cloth 21 to the first and second coupling rings 51 and 52 is further optimized. The sealing cloth 21 without the teflon coating at both ends of the sealing cloth 21 is called as a fixed cloth 1, and the method for making the sealing cloth 21 without the teflon coating at both ends can be made by leaving white on both ends of the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th in advance, or by polishing both ends of the sealing cloth 21 with a grinding wheel to remove the teflon coating.
Cutting a plurality of gaps with the length of 50-100cm from the two ends of the fixed cloth 1 to form a plurality of cloth strips 2, as shown in figure 12; coating metal glue on two ends of the fixed cloth 1, arranging a plurality of cloth penetrating holes 31 for allowing the cloth strips 2 to penetrate through on the surface of the fixed plate 3, wherein the cloth penetrating holes 31 can be set to be half of the number of the cloth strips 2 according to requirements, enabling half of the cloth strips 2 to penetrate through the cloth penetrating holes 31 for folding, arranging pressing plates 5 above and below the fixed cloth 1, and coating the metal glue between the pressing plates 5 and the fixed plate 3, as shown in fig. 13; wherein the fixing plate 3 is the inner edge 512 or the turned-over edge 522. With this fixing, the connection between the sealing cloth 21 and the first and second coupling rings 51 and 52 becomes more stable.
In the above embodiment, the main body of the sealing cloth 21 is a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th, which has high longitudinal and transverse tensile strength (over 2000MPa), and can be used for bearing the sodium sulfide crude alkali solution above. When the air bag is installed, the aluminum foil surface is positioned inside the air bag space 22, and the polytetrafluoroethylene coating is positioned outside the air bag space 22; the polytetrafluoroethylene has excellent heat resistance and cold resistance, has the characteristics of acid resistance, alkali resistance and various organic solvents resistance, is almost insoluble in all solvents, and has an extremely low friction coefficient, so that a large amount of alkali mud is not easy to adhere to the outer surface layer of the sealing cloth 21. The teflon and the aluminum foil have excellent sealability, so that the sealing cloth 21 has excellent waterproof performance. The roughness of the surface of the glass fiber cloth of the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th is large, and the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th is easy to be combined with a subsequent coating.
In all the above embodiments, the aluminum foil composite glass fiber cloth with the polytetrafluoroethylene coating is sintered at 375-380 ℃, and nitrogen is used as a shielding gas during sintering.
